У нас вы можете посмотреть бесплатно leetcode 53 - Maximum Subarray | Optimal Approach in JAVA. или скачать в максимальном доступном качестве, видео которое было загружено на ютуб. Для загрузки выберите вариант из формы ниже:
Если кнопки скачивания не
загрузились
НАЖМИТЕ ЗДЕСЬ или обновите страницу
Если возникают проблемы со скачиванием видео, пожалуйста напишите в поддержку по адресу внизу
страницы.
Спасибо за использование сервиса ClipSaver.ru
Maximum Subarray – Kadane’s Algorithm (LeetCode 53) The problem is to find the contiguous subarray within an array that has the largest possible sum. Algorithm (in words): Start with two variables: one to store the current subarray sum and one to store the maximum sum found so far. Traverse the array from left to right. For each element, decide whether to add it to the current subarray or start a new subarray beginning at that element (whichever gives a larger sum). Update the maximum sum whenever the current subarray sum becomes larger than the previously recorded maximum. At the end of the traversal, the maximum sum variable holds the largest subarray sum. Time Complexity: O(n) Space Complexity: O(1)